本资源主要聚焦于VB(Visual Basic)数据对象及数据库访问机制,特别是数据引擎在其中的作用。VB数据库访问技术的核心在于理解如何利用VB语言与SQL(Structured Query Language)语句结合,通过ADO(ActiveX Data Objects)数据模型构建数据库应用程序。教学内容包括以下关键知识点:
1. **VB数据库访问技术概论**:介绍了VB中数据库访问的背景和基本概念,强调了数据库应用程序的前后台架构,前台由VB程序组成,后台是数据库管理系统或数据文件,两者之间的通信依赖于数据库引擎。
2. **VB中的数据库类型**:
- **本地数据库**:以Microsoft Access为例,用于存储和管理数据。
- **外部数据库**:如dBase、Foxpro、Paradox和Excel等,使用ISAM(Indexed Sequential Access Method)。
- **远程数据库**:如SQL Server、Oracle、DB2等大型数据库,是现代大型应用程序的常见选择。
3. **常用的数据库引擎**:
- **Jet引擎**:适用于本地和外部数据库,也支持远程数据库(通过ODBC桥接)。
- **ODBC(Open Database Connectivity)**:标准化的数据库接口,支持大部分DBMS,提供数据库与应用程序间的抽象层。
- **OLEDB(Object Linking and Embedding for Database)**:由Microsoft提出,用于更高效地与各种类型的数据库交互。
4. **数据库操作实践**:涵盖了如何在VB中执行"增删改查"操作,以及利用工具如数据管理器创建数据库和数据访问界面,例如通过“数据窗体向导”。
5. **教学目标**:明确指出学生需要掌握VB数据库访问技术,包括对VB语言和SQL的理解,以及如何将SQL语句嵌入到VB程序中。
通过学习这些内容,读者将能熟练运用VB语言开发出能够与不同类型的数据库高效交互的应用程序,并理解数据引擎在前后端通信中的核心地位。